US Ambassador to Ukraine turned out to be a fan of “Ocean Elzi”
US Ambassador to Ukraine Geoffrey Pyatt admitted his passion for the work of Ocean Elzy.
The official, coming to the studio of the morning show “Breakfast with 1+1”, spoke about his musical tastes. When it came to Payette’s favorite group, he named the Ukrainian “OE”.
“Okean Elzy” is my favorite Ukrainian group. I’m a big fan of them,” said Jeffrey.
In addition, the ambassador added that he loves the work of Ukrainian singers – Jamala and Ruslana. “I also really like Jamala. She is very talented, like everyone else in Ukraine. It’s still hard not to love Ruslana,” Payette noted.

Susanna Jamaladinova, known as Jamala, is an opera and jazz singer who became popular after performing at the New Wave 2008 in Jurmala, where she received the Grand Prix.
Ruslana Lyzhychko, known simply as Ruslana, is a popular singer in Ukraine. Her success skyrocketed after winning the Eurovision Song Contest in 2004. Ruslana uses Hutsul motifs in her arrangements, the sounds of trembita and other folk instruments along with modern dance sounds. She was also an active participant in the 2013-14 Dignity Revolution.
